Analysis
In 2024, plywood and lvl — import value in Eastern Africa stood at 98,685 1000 USD.
The figure is down 13.2% on the previous year and down 3.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, plywood and lvl — import value in Eastern Africa peaked at 142,461 1000 USD in 2021 and was at its lowest, 937 1000 USD, in 1961.
Eastern Africa ranks 26th of 33 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 2,755 1000 USD | 937 1000 USD | 4,840 1000 USD | 9 |
| 1970s | 7,134 1000 USD | 4,885 1000 USD | 10,178 1000 USD | 10 |
| 1980s | 9,887 1000 USD | 6,114 1000 USD | 16,767 1000 USD | 10 |
| 1990s | 20,484 1000 USD | 17,997 1000 USD | 22,908 1000 USD | 10 |
| 2000s | 31,717 1000 USD | 21,936 1000 USD | 55,660 1000 USD | 10 |
| 2010s | 88,933 1000 USD | 46,133 1000 USD | 119,918 1000 USD | 10 |
| 2020s | 120,499 1000 USD | 98,685 1000 USD | 142,461 1000 USD | 5 |

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
